Research Skilled LPN/LVN Job Trends in Allston

If you’re a Skilled LPN/LVN curious about Travel job trends in Allston, MA,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 7 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,725 and a range from $1,641 to $1,809 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 02134.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Skilled LPN/LVNs in Allston’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Skilled LPN/LVNs Expect in Allston, MA?

As a Skilled LPN/LVN in Allston, Massachusetts, you can expect a diverse array of work opportunities across various healthcare facilities. From community health clinics and outpatient surgical centers to rehabilitation and long-term care facilities, your role will be critical in delivering high-quality patient care. You’ll engage in tasks such as administering medications, assisting with patient assessments, and providing essential support to registered nurses and physicians. Additionally, you may work in specialized areas such as pediatrics or geriatrics, ensuring that you address the unique needs of each patient population. 76 Beds Adults & Geriatrics Ratio: 1:25 Top 10 Diagnosis/Procedures: alzheimers, dementia, stroke, diabetes, parkinsons, COPD, CHF, cancer, dialysis Any special procedure done on the unit? Feeding tubes, IV’s, Bariatric, wound care/wound vacs, trachs/suctioning
